Try CLASSIC LOST MOVIES HAMMEROLDIES HOMEPAGE I got a good DVD of "THE BRIGAND OF KANDAHAR" 1965 from them a couple of years ago. It looks like a TV copy off of a video tape onto DVD which gives that ghost effect to some of the rich colours. The big shame is it's in full screen. It starts with the Columbia girl and titles in 2.35 Hammerscope then goes to full screen which is why I think its a TV recording.
"THE BRIGAND OF KANDAHAR" originated from Warwick Films "ZARAK" 1959 that stared Victor Mature. Some of John Gilling 2nd unit action sequences were cut from "ZARAK" and Columbia suggested he incorporate the cut scenes into another prodject. So Gilling took his new story to Hammer and they let him direct it. Also of intrest as Oliver Reeds last film for Hammer. |
